[ORIGINAL ARTICLE: NOVEMBER 10, 2020]
Samsung is now rolling out a new software update for the Galaxy Watch 3 in South Korea. It comes with a build version R840XXU1BTK1 that weighs 63MB. This update improves the measurement of the blood oxygen saturation feature.
The latest firmware update also adds voice guidance support in the Galaxy Watch 3 for the exercises. The voice guidance feature provides helpful tips to you when you are doing exercise.

Moreover, voice guidance also added for the expanded distance and heart rate when you are running or your biking activity. The update comes with some bug fixes and stability improvements for the smart wearable.
READ MORE: How to update software and apps on your Samsung Galaxy Watch
This update is currently rolling out in South Korea and it should soon be available in other countries in the coming days/weeks.
FOLLOW THE STEPS TO UPDATE WATCH SOFTWARE USING THE PHONE
- Launch Galaxy Wearable app.
- Tap on Home > Watches software update.
- Tap on Download and install.
- Tap on Install now if an update is available.

Galaxy Watch 6 gets Samsung Health TV pairing feature in the US
After the initial rollout in South Korea, the Samsung Health TV pairing feature for the Galaxy Watch 6 series has now made its way to the US. Yes, the update is rolling out for the locked variants of Galaxy Watch 6 and Galaxy Watch 6 Classic on Verizon, while, other networks will also collect it soon.
This all-new Samsung Health TV pairing feature is been released for Galaxy Watch 6 devices with the March 2024 update and it allows users to view their exercise data from the Galaxy Watch directly on their TV screen. This will result in better health monitoring and optimize the overall user experience.
This feature will work ultimately when you’re watching a movie or other content on a Samsung Smart TV and working out at the same time. As it will let you view your exercise measurement data on your TV by simply selecting the Connect TV button on your watch for seamless visuals and better understanding.
It’s worth noting that, this new feature only supports Samsung Smart TVs, Smart Monitors, Projectors, and Lifestyle products released in the year 2024. Simultaneously, both the Samsung TV and Galaxy Watch must be registered under the same Samsung account for an appropriate connection.

In addition to this new addition, the latest update will also enhance the security and stability grades of your Galaxy Watch and resolve common issues to offer a hassle-free performance and improve health accuracy. Thus, we recommend users to upgrade their Galaxy Watch to latest version.
The consumers of the Galaxy Watch 6 40mm variant will be able to determine the latest update through version R935USQU1AXB7 and R945USQU1AXB7 for the 44mm variant. While the 43mm and 47mm versions of Galaxy Watch 6 Classic carry build R955USQU1AXB7 and R965USQU1AXB7 respectively.

Samsung has rolled out an update for the Galaxy Watch 3 Plugin, enhancing the user experience by addressing previous issues. The update arrives with version 2.2.09.24012551.
The Galaxy Watch 3 Plugin is an essential app for connecting the Galaxy Watch 3 to the Galaxy Wearable app on smartphones, allowing for comprehensive customization and management of watch settings.
